As much as I'm enjoying the MOMENTUM, my sonic preferences lean more toward the Amperior. The comfort, though...for me the MOMENTUM is far more comfortable than the Amperior (or any of my other on-ears), and enough so that I'm grabbing the MOMENTUM more often the Amperior (or the DT 1350 or M-80) lately.
 
That said, if I'm listening more critically (like I'm evaluating some other piece of gear in the chain), I'd turn to one of the other three over the MOMENTUM.
 
 
...And according to what I'm reading, the momentum are not over- the ear but a hybrid between over and on.

 
To me the MOMENTUM feels more like a circumaural (around the ear) more than a supra-aural (on-the-ear). That said, it's on the smaller side of circumaurals, so for some it might feel more like a cross between the two. Also helping that is comparatively low clamping force on the MOMENTUM, as well as the super-cushy earpads.
